Skip to content

Commit f7d0052

Browse files
authored
Merge pull request #46 from isomd/master
全局提示词优化,限制ai目的
2 parents 33903e8 + 27de027 commit f7d0052

2 files changed

Lines changed: 3 additions & 6 deletions

File tree

prompto-lab-app/src/main/java/io/github/timemachinelab/controller/UserInteractionController.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-272,7 +272,7 @@ public ResponseEntity<String> processAnswer(@Validated @RequestBody UnifiedAnswe
272272
}
273273

274274
// 答案更新逻辑已在MessageProcessingService中处理
275-
275+
messageProcessingService.processAnswer(request);
276276
// 4. 处理答案并转换为消息
277277
String processedMessage = messageProcessingService.preprocessMessage(
278278
null, // 没有额外的原始消息

prompto-lab-app/src/main/java/io/github/timemachinelab/core/constant/AllPrompt.java

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-4,11 +4,8 @@ public class AllPrompt {
44

55
public static final String ALL_PROMPT = """
66
# 全局提示词
7-
##描述
8-
请根据当前用户身份画像、规则和需求的明确程度,围绕着用户需求,
9-
选择最合适的交互方式来进一步挖掘或确认需求,当出现不符合用户身份画像的问题时,对问题中的专业名词做出一定解释。
10-
你需通过引导式提问,结合用户身份、场景、目标等画像信息,层层挖掘其真实需求与深层意图,构建精准上下文,最终帮助用户生成让大模型秒懂并完美执行的高质量提示词。请先分析当前上下文,判断用户需求处于哪个阶段,
11-
然后直接以选定的形式对应的输出格式进行返回,无需额外解释选择原因。
7+
## 描述
8+
你是一个ai提示词生成专家,你需通过引导式提问,结合用户身份、场景、目标等画像信息,层层挖掘其真实需求与深层意图,构建精准上下文,最终帮助用户生成让大模型秒懂并完美执行的高质量提示词。请根据当前用户身份画像、规则和需求的明确程度,围绕着用户需求,选择最合适的交互方式来进一步挖掘或确认需求,当出现不符合用户身份画像的问题时,对问题中的专业名词做出一定解释。请先分析当前上下文,判断用户需求处于哪个阶段,然后直接以选定的形式对应的输出格式进行返回,无需额外解释选择原因。
129
1310
## 规则
1411
1.规则分为通用规则和条件触发规则,通用规则无需触发,是每次回答必须满足的规则;条件触发规则是由对应触发规则所触发。

0 commit comments

Comments
 (0)